Разработчики Ubuntu сообщили о внесении корректировок в метод реализации режима безопасной загрузки UEFI в Ubuntu. Изначально разработчики были намерены использовать отдельный первичный загрузчик EFILinux, манипулирующий проверочными ключами Canonical. Новый план подразумевает использование штатного загрузчика GRUB 2, без лишних прослоек. Так же сообщается, что в будущих выпусках Ubuntu 12.10 и 12.04.2 будет использован только GRUB 2.
Подобное решение принято после проведения консультации с Фондом СПО и юристами по вопросу ограничений, накладываемых лицензией GPLv3. Дополнительный загрузчик хотели использовать из-за опасения, что могут возникнуть проблемы при использовании загрузчика GRUB 2, распространяемого под лицензией GPLv3, которая запрещает тивоизацию. Использование GRUB 2 в ситуации, если производитель нарушит требования Canonical и не реализует в прошивке возможность отключения режима безопасной загрузки, может быть рассмотрена как нарушение лицензии GPLv3. В этом случае юристы Canonical опасались, что для выполнения условий лицензии GPLv3, компанию могут обязать предоставить в открытый доступ закрытые ключи, использованные для формирования цифровой подписи. Фонд СПО развеял подобное опасение и указал, что ответственность будет лежать на производителе, не выполнившем условия контракта, поэтому лицензия GPLv3 не мешает изначальному использованию GRUB2 и не может привести к принуждению к публикации закрытых ключей.
Читать